2018 Citroen Berlingo fuel consumption
5 versions rated. Official figures from the Australian Government’s Green Vehicle Guide.
Fuel use, combined
4.0–7.1 L/100km
lower is better
Cost to run a year
$1,338–$1,998
at 14,000km
CO₂ from the exhaust
106–164 g/km
per kilometre
Uses 45% less fuel than the typical 2018 car, which averaged 7.3 L/100km.
Every 2018 Citroen Berlingo version
| Version | Engine | Fuel use | City | Highway | Cost/year | CO₂ |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Long Body 2 Seat BlueHDi 74kW ETG6 Van Auto | 1.6L 4cyl Turbo Diesel | 4.0 | 4.3 | 3.9 | $1,338 | 106 Better than average |
| Long Body 3 Seat BlueHDi 74kW ETG6 Van Auto | 1.6L 4cyl Turbo Diesel | 4.0 | 4.3 | 3.9 | $1,338 | 106 Better than average |
| Long Body 2 Seat HDi 66kW MT5 Van Manual | 1.6L 4cyl Turbo Diesel | 5.0 | 5.6 | 4.7 | $1,673 | 132 Better than average |
| Long Body 3 Seat HDi 66kW MT5 Van Manual | 1.6L 4cyl Turbo Diesel | 5.0 | 5.6 | 4.7 | $1,673 | 132 Better than average |
| Short Body 2 Seat VTi 72kW MT5 Van Manual | 1.6L 4cyl Petrol 95RON | 7.1 | 9.6 | 5.7 | $1,998 | 164 Slightly better than average |

Figures come from a standardised laboratory test, so every car is measured the same way. Your own fuel use will differ with traffic, load, tyre pressure and how you drive. Running costs assume 14,000km a year at recent average fuel prices.
